| VERB | change | degauss, demagnetize, demagnetise | make nonmagnetic |
|---|
| Meaning | make nonmagnetic; take away the magnetic properties (of). | |
|---|---|---|
| Pattern | Somebody ----s something; Something ----s something | |
| Example | "they degaussed the ship" | |
| Synonyms | demagnetize, demagnetise | |
| Category | physics, natural philosophy | The science of matter and energy and their interactions |
| Broader | change, alter, modify | Cause to change |
| Opposite | magnetize, magnetise | make magnetic |
| Spanish | desimantar | |
| Catalan | desimantar, desmagnetitzar | |
| Nouns | degaussing | the process of making a (steel) ship's hull nonmagnetic by producing an opposing magnetic field |
